Short-Term Rental Regulations
in Rockaway Beach, OR
Last verified: March 2026 · Report an update
Zoning & Conditions
STRs are capped at 420 total licenses city-wide. Requirements include: 24/7 local agent availability with a 30-minute in-person response time, mandatory off-street parking, proof of liability insurance, and visible street address/signage. Licenses are valid from July 1 to June 30 and require annual renewal.
How to Obtain a Permit
1) Submit a complete application via the City STR Registration Portal and pay the $500 new-license fee. 2) Upload required documents including photos of address/signage, a parking plan diagram, proof of liability insurance, and local agent contact info. 3) The City reviews the application (minimum 14 business days); once approved, licenses must be renewed annually by June 30.
